Added all extensions used by the mov muxer family
---
libavformat/mov.c | 2 +-
1 file changed, 1 insertion(+), 1 deletion(-)
diff --git a/libavformat/mov.c b/libavformat/mov.c
index 589576b529..21a5a0180e 100644
--- a/libavformat/mov.c
+++ b/libavformat/mov.c
@@ -8073,7 +8073,7 @@ AVInputFormat ff_mov_demuxer = {
.long_name = NULL_IF_CONFIG_SMALL("QuickTime / MOV"),
.priv_class = &mov_class,
.priv_data_size = sizeof(MOVContext),
- .extensions = "mov,mp4,m4a,3gp,3g2,mj2",
+ .extensions = "mov,mp4,m4a,3gp,3g2,mj2,psp,m4v,m4b,ism,ismv,isma,f4v",
Is this supposed to fix anything?
I ask because iirc the demuxer does not work for files not detected or do I
misremember?
Keeping the list up to date.
I believe patches should at least theoretically fix issues but imo, feel free
to remove extensions for this demuxer if it makes you feel better.
I'm *adding* extensions.
Since you are not claiming to fix an issue (or a theoretical issue), I was
assuming you don't like to have an incomplete-looking list in the file.
If that is correct, removing it is an option, no?
An empty list is even more incomplete.
As I mentioned, the benefit is for cli users able to specify `-f ext`
as well as `-h demuxer=ext`
I understand now.
At least the m4v suffix is not such a good idea.
What does it clash with? Raw MPEG-4 Part 2 bitstreams?
Yes.
Will remove.
